Carnival
We walked into town and back yesterday, to spend the afternoon at the carnival...part of the Monmouth Festival 2010. It was a hot day and lots of people had turned out to see the brass band, market, carnival floats and a special drive past from over 100 Rolls Royces.
It is 100 years since the death of Charles Rolls, founder of Rolls Royce. The cars drove past the newly spruced up Town Hall and his memorial statue in Agincourt Square.
It was a lovely occasion...people smiling and cheering as the runners ran past on their way to the Kymin Dash challenge.

Hokey Pokey
Hokey Pokey is a cornish term for honeycomb.
Mix 100g of caster sugar with 4 tablespoons of golden syrup in a saucepan. Do not stir once it is on the heat. Place pan on heat and let it turn to goo and then bubble. Take off heat and whisk in 1 and half teaspoons of bicarb of soda. Tip onto greased foil and leave to cool and set. Break up into pieces.
No one can resist Hokey Pokey.
